2. How to Fix a Leaky Kitchen Sink

A leaky kitchen sink can be a frustrating and messy problem to deal with. Not only does it waste water, but it can also cause damage to your sink and cabinets. If you're handy with tools and have some basic plumbing knowledge, you may be able to fix a leaky kitchen sink yourself.

Start by turning off the water supply and removing any items from under the sink. Then, identify the source of the leak and tighten any loose connections. If the leak persists, you may need to replace the faulty part, such as the faucet or pipe.

5. Kitchen Sink Plumbing Repair Cost

The cost of kitchen sink plumbing repairs can vary depending on the severity of the issue and the type of repair needed. Minor repairs, such as fixing a leaky faucet, may cost anywhere from $100 to $200. However, more complex issues, such as a broken pipe, may cost upwards of $500.

It's important to get a quote from a plumbing service before agreeing to any repairs to avoid any surprises. Some companies may offer a flat rate for certain repairs, while others charge by the hour. It's also a good idea to inquire about any warranties or guarantees on their work.

8. Tips for Maintaining Your Kitchen Sink Plumbing

To avoid frequent kitchen sink plumbing repairs, it's important to maintain your plumbing regularly. Here are a few tips to keep your kitchen sink plumbing in good working condition:

- Avoid putting large food scraps or grease down the drain.

- Install a sink strainer to catch any debris before it enters the drain.

- Regularly clean your sink and faucet to prevent build-up and corrosion.

- Fix any leaks or issues as soon as they arise to prevent further damage.

Identify the Problem

kitchen sink plumbing repair The first step in repairing your kitchen sink plumbing is to identify the problem. Is the sink clogged? Is there a leak? Is the water not draining properly? It's important to determine the source of the issue before attempting any repairs. If you're unsure, it's best to call a professional plumber who can diagnose the problem and provide a solution. Kitchen sink clogs are a common issue and can be caused by a variety of factors such as food scraps, grease buildup, or foreign objects. To prevent clogs, avoid pouring cooking oil or grease down the drain and use a drain strainer to catch food debris. If your sink is already clogged, try using a plunger or a commercial drain cleaner to clear the blockage. Leaks are another common problem with kitchen sinks. They can be caused by worn out gaskets, loose connections, or cracks in the pipes. To locate the source of the leak, dry the area around the sink and turn on the water. If you spot any water dripping from the pipes or connections, they may need to be tightened or replaced.

Regular Maintenance

kitchen sink plumbing repair Prevention is key when it comes to kitchen sink plumbing. Regular maintenance can help you avoid costly repairs and keep your sink functioning properly. One simple way to maintain your sink is to regularly clean the drain and pipes using a mixture of hot water and vinegar. This will help break down any buildup and keep the pipes clear. It's also important to check for leaks periodically. Look for any signs of water damage or mold around the sink, as well as any dripping or pooling water. Catching leaks early can prevent them from causing further damage and save you money in the long run.
